A review of Butterick Culottes B6178

Reviewed by joy.margot on 7th February, 2019

I usually avoid Big 4 patterns due to the bizarre sizing and sparse instructions, but I’d seen a few pairs of these crop up on Instagram and managed to nab the pattern for a couple of quid in a de-stash. I usually wear a UK 8-10 but my measurements put me between a 12 and 14. Knowing that Big 4 patterns tend to come up large, I made the size 12 and they fit perfectly.

I made view D which just has front and back darts. I like the more voluminous versions I’ve seen, but I used a medium/heavy-weight twill from my stash and thought they’d be a bit bulky with extra pleats. I don’t totally love how the in-seam pockets sit as the hips are quite fitted, and I’d be tempted to switch these for front pockets next time.

Overall, these were a quick sew and they fit well. (Edited to add: The back waistband and the pockets gape a lot and I would alter both of these next time). I’m sure I’ll be adding another pair to my summer wardrobe this year!
